Blugolds Score Three Unanswered Goals to Yellowjackets, 3-1

EAU CLAIRE, Wis. -- Junior forward Phillip Eriksen (Skjetten, Norway/Lorenskog) scored for the third time in two matches on Tuesday, giving the UW-Superior men's soccer to an early lead, but UW-Eau Claire scored three unanswered goals for a 3-1 win at Bollinger Field.
 
Ericksen finished off a feed from sophomore Mackie Ringrose (Ewhurst, England/St Peter's Catholic School) at the top of the 18-yard box at the 12:08 mark of the opening half. 
 
The Blugolds (6-0-0) knotted the match through Nathan Donovan in the 19th minute with assists from Will Heinen and Scott Hanson. Donovan put the ball home from just outside the six-yard box, high into the center of the next for his fourth goal of the season.
 
Just 1:18 later, Heinen scored his second of the season from Carter Thiesfeld on a strike from the outside the penalty area for the game-winning goal.
 
Donovan put the match out of reach with the 87th minute with his second goal of the night, assisted by Jacob Sampson, for the final margin.
 
The Blugolds had 54 percent of the possession throughout, and outshot UWS, 18-10. Eau Claire put nine shots on target, compared to four for the Yellowjackets.
 
Sophomore goalkeeper Alex Paredes (Mequon, Wis./Homestead) fell on 2-1-0 on the season with the loss, while making six saves. UWEC's Spencer Banks turned aside three shots for the win, improving to 4-0-0.
 
UWS (2-2-0) next begins Upper Midwest Athletic Conference play Saturday at Northland. Kickoff is slated for 7 p.m., at Ponzio Stadium.
